Surprise -- a crossover between the many worlds of Mr. Parker; primariily Sunny Randall and Jesse Stone, working on a case together and getting together (as each is finally figuring out that they're most likely NOT getting back together with their respective ex-spouses.) And hey - Sunny Randall's shrink is Susan Silverman, Spenser's girlfriend. And they spend a big chunk of the book in Los Angeles instead of Boston.
Like most Parker novels, this was a very, very, very fast read: mostly dialog, not too much pesky detail. Should keep a smirk on your face for 45 minutes, at least.
